Further, the use of recycled materials in housing projects has the potential to lower costs by 10-20% compared to conventional materials ( Building Design, 2024). Low- cost sustainable materials offer dual benefit: they reduce expenses associated with raw materials and contribute to embodied carbon reduction in building practices.

Value engineering Rising construction costs and budget squeezes mean architects have to compare the functions and properties of different materials in order to achieve the desired outcome at the lowest cost . Architects have to identify cost -saving opportunities without compromising performance.
